Accessible Ramp Installation in Wilmington, NC
Accessible ramp installation services provide property owners with solutions to improve mobility and accessibility around residential and commercial properties. These services typically include the design, construction, and installation of ramps that accommodate wheelchairs, walkers, and other mobility devices. Projects can range from installing portable or permanent ramps at entryways, including porches, stairs, and doorways, to creating custom ramps for uneven terrain or multi-level properties. Homeowners often seek these services to ensure compliance with accessibility needs, enhance safety, or prepare properties for aging in place or accommodating visitors with mobility challenges.
Before requesting accessible ramp installation, property owners should consider factors such as the location where the ramp will be installed, the type of surface or terrain, and the weight capacity required. It’s also helpful to have measurements of the entry points and a clear understanding of any local building codes or regulations that might affect the design. Knowing the specific needs of users, such as wheelchair width or preferred slope, can help in planning a suitable solution. This preparation ensures the installation process is efficient and results in a safe, functional access point tailored to the property’s requirements.

Accessible Ramp Installation Questions
What types of ramps are suitable for residential properties? Residential ramps typically include permanent concrete or wood structures, as well as portable aluminum options for flexibility.
What should property owners consider before installing a ramp? It's important to assess the available space, the slope for accessibility, and any local building codes or regulations.
Are there design options to match existing property features? Yes, ramps can be customized with different materials, finishes, and colors to complement the property's aesthetic.
What is the primary purpose of installing an accessible ramp? The main goal is to improve mobility and ensure safe, convenient access to the property for all visitors.
